If you were awake bright and early Wednesday morning, you might have seen a spectacular sky sight over Missouri. It was a mammoth meteor that fortunately exploded over the state and was witnessed as far away as Nebraska.

According to the American Meteor Society website, this space rock was photographed from Albany, Missouri at approximately 6:06am Wednesday, February 28, 2024 by Dan Bush of the Missouri Skies YouTube channel.

The report map from the American Meteor Society shows this meteor was big enough to be viewed over a 5-state region including Missouri, Kansas, Iowa and Nebraska.

That makes this space rock once of the most reported meteors of 2024 so far. Dan Bush does a great job of also capturing videos of meteors, so I'll update this article with that if one is shared.
